#26: Bridging the Gap: Translating Internal MA into Useful Feedback

February 24, 2026 in Technical Skills, Cross-Discipline
► Recording Coming Soon

Featuring: Stephen Gover

Cross-Discipline
Do you ever struggle to translate the movement analysis you've done in your head into clear and useful feedback for your students? In this tech talk, Stephen explores strategies you can use to turn complex technical concepts into specific, clear, and actionable feedback.
